Output 7c61dadd3fc345570ceb1deee5263ecc18fa59c49770a23b69b845393e17eabb:1

value
5145098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d682a2f93017da967984517ef95fc57e8607be66 OP_EQUAL
address
3MFF2PNjSWbdU3Hdd2RCjT7i3eARv2n83t
transaction
7c61dadd3fc345570ceb1deee5263ecc18fa59c49770a23b69b845393e17eabb
confirmations
287567
spent
true